Our Journey: From Heartbreak to Hope

In 2013, Kim Brown began her journey of fostering and volunteering with rescues, quickly falling in love with her first two fosters. However, in 2015, tragedy struck when she lost her younger brother, Matthew, to suicide. His battle with bipolar disorder left a profound impact on her life. In the wake of this loss, Kimmy found solace in helping animals in her community, realizing that they needed her just as much as she needed them. This heartfelt connection led to the creation of Kimmy’s Safe Haven Rescue, a place where every animal is given a second chance at life and love.
